NEW: Online version of student directory
We are pleased to announce the launch of the first online edition of the student, Faculty and Staff directory. For the first time, there’s a web version of the venerable “facebook” that has been printed annually for decades (not to be confused with the student-run Facebook.com networking site).
A personal project of Dean Robert MacDonald, this is a useful new resource for all of us. It’s not meant to replace the print copy, but to enhance and update it.
CURRENT FEATURES:
* Password-protected full access from any web browser in the world.
* Each student entry has a more detailed profile, including room for Journalism Focus; Favorite Book; Languages Spoken Fluently
* Most student photos in full color.
* Two modes: Table mode and Book mode. Table mode allows you to see a simple list of names that you can click on to get to the profiles. Book mode allows you to see the photos next to each name, sort of laid out like the print version. On any page, you can switch back and forth.
* You can browse, by alphabetical order, just the student listings or the just the Faculty/Staff listings.
* There’s a keyword search that is very useful. It searches last names or first names (very useful if you remember, as it often happens only a person’s first name) and, in an exciting development for the Career Services office, by languages spoken.
* Some common names: Davids (nine), Elizabeths (seven)…
* Some common languages: Spanish (48), French (47), Chinese/Mandarin/Cantonese (13), German (13), Hindi (12), Arabic (5)…
* Can’t search by favorite books yet
* I don’t know if this is a bug or a feature, but you can search parts of names as well.
eg, If you type in just “ree” you get the last names Freedlander, Freedman, Sreenivasan and the first names Maureen and Nisreen. Not sure how useful this is, but might come in handy if you only know part of a name.
